Chapter 56 55 Chu and Han struggle

Han Wang Liu Bang worshiped Han Xin as a general and Xiao He as a prime minister, rectified the rear and trained his troops.In August 206 BC, Han Wang and Han Xin led the Han army to attack Guanzhong.The people in Guanzhong originally had a good impression of the King of Han in the "Three Chapters of the Covenant", but when the Han army arrived, most of them were unwilling to resist.In less than three months, the King of Han wiped out the troops of Zhang Han, the former general of the State of Qin, and the Guanzhong area became the territory of the King of Han. This made Xiang Yu, the Overlord of Western Chu, very angry.Xiang Yu planned to send troops to the west to attack Liu Bang, but something happened in the east. Tian Rong of Qi State blasted away the king of Qi that Xiang Yu had appointed, and made himself king. The situation was more serious than in the west.Xiang Yu had no choice but to deal with Qi State first.

Liu Bang, king of Han, took advantage of Xiang Yu's stalemate with Qi to fight eastward and captured Pengcheng, the capital of the overlord of Western Chu.Xiang Yu had no choice but to abandon the other side of Qi, and rushed back to fight the Han army on the Sui River. The Han army was defeated. I don't know how many people fell into the water and drowned, and many were captured. The father of the King of Han, Grand Duke, and his wife, Queen Lu, were also captured by the Chu army. The king of Han withdrew to Rongyang and Chenggao (both in present-day Xingyang County, Henan Province) to collect scattered soldiers.At this time, Xiao He sent a team from Guanzhong, and Han Xin also brought an army to meet the King of Han, and the Han army cheered up again.

The king of Han adopted the method of attacking and defending. On the one hand, he defended Xingyang and held Xiang Yu's army with a small number of troops; Xiang Yu's counselor, Fan Zeng, advised Xiang Yu to take Xingyang quickly.The king of Han was very anxious.His counselor, Chen Ping, originally defected from Xiang Yu, and offered a plan to drive a wedge between Xiang Yu and Fan Zeng. Xiang Yu is a very suspicious person, and he was caught in a trick, and he really became suspicious of Fan Zeng.Fan Zeng was very angry, and said to Xiang Yu: "The great affairs of the world have been decided. Your Majesty, please do it yourself. I am old and frail, and it is time to go back to my hometown."

Fan Zeng left Xingyang, angry and sad all the way, fell ill, did not return to Pengcheng, and died of malignant sores on his spine. After Fan Zeng died, there was no one in the Chu camp to advise Bawang.The pressure on the Han army also eased.The king of Han used a small number of troops to restrain Xiang Yu's forces in the Xingyang and Chenggao areas, and ordered Han Xin to continue to attack the north and east. He also ordered General Peng Yue to cut off the Chu army's grain transportation behind the Chu army, so that Xiang Yu's army had to fight back and forth. Chu and Han confronted each other for more than two years.

In 203 BC, Xiang Yu went to attack Pengyue by himself, leaving his general Cao Jiu to guard Chenggao, repeatedly enjoining him not to fight the Han army. When the king of Han saw that Xiang Yu had left, he challenged Cao Jiu.At first, Cao Jiu didn't say anything and didn't come out to fight.The king of Han ordered his soldiers to insult the Chu camp all day long across the Si River (which flows through the west of Xingyang, Si sounds like si). After scolding for several days, Cao Jiu couldn't hold his breath anymore, so he decided to cross the Si River and fight the Han army to the death.

The Chu army had many soldiers and few boats, so they had to cross the river in batches.When the Chu army had just crossed halfway, the Han army defeated the front army of the Chu army, and the rear army fell into disarray and trampled on each other.Cao Jiu felt ashamed to see Xiang Yu again, so he committed suicide by the Sishui. Xiang Yu was winning the battle in the east, and when he heard that Cheng Gao had fallen, he rushed to the west to deal with the King of Han.In Guangwu (now northeast of Xingyang County, Henan Province), the Chu and Han armies faced off again. After a long time, the food of the Chu army could not meet.Xiang Yu had no choice but to tie up Hanwang's father, put him on the pig slaughter case, and sent someone to shout:

"Liu Bang killed your father before he surrendered." Knowing that Xiang Yu was threatening him, the King of Han replied loudly, "You and I were brothers once, and my father is also your father. If you kill your father and cook it into meat soup, please give me a bowl to taste." Xiang Yu gritted his teeth with hatred, and really wanted to kill the grandpa, but Xiang Bo persuaded him again. Xiang Yu sent an envoy to say to the King of Han, "The world is in turmoil right now, because you and I are at loggerheads. Do you dare to come out and compare yourself with me?" The King of Han asked the envoy to reply, "I can fight you, I won't compete with you."

Xiang Yu asked the King of Han to come out again and talk before the battle.The King of Han denounced Xiang Yu's ten crimes face to face, saying that he was not faithful, killed Emperor Yi, massacred the people and so on.Xiang Yu got angry when he heard this, and pointed forward with his halberd, and the archers behind him all fired arrows.The king of Han hurried back to his horse, but was seriously injured by an arrow in his chest. He held back the pain, bent his waist and touched his feet on purpose, and said cursingly, "The thief shot my toe." Left and right helped the King of Han into the camp.When the Han army heard that the King of Han was injured, they panicked.Zhang Liang was afraid that the army's morale would be shaken, so he persuaded the king of Han to get up, and went to the barracks to inspect it, and everyone settled down.

Xiang Yu was disappointed when he heard that the King of Han was not dead.Then, Han Xin defeated the Chu army in Qi, and Peng Yue cut off the Chu army's grain transportation route, and the grain and grass became less and less. Taking advantage of Xiang Yu's difficult situation, the king of Han sent someone to make peace with Xiang Yu, asking for the release of the Grand Duke and Empress Lu, and suggested that Chu and Han should use the boundary between Chu and Han (in the southeast of Xingyang), and the east of the gap should belong to Chu, and the west of the gap should belong to Han.

Xiang Yu thought it was not bad to delineate the "Chu River-Han Boundary" in this way, so he agreed, released the Grand Duke and Queen Lu, and then brought his troops back to Pengcheng. In fact, the king of Han's peace talks this time was just a tactic to slow down the army.Using Zhang Liang and Chen Ping's strategy, the king of Han organized Han Xin, Peng Yue, and Yingbu to join forces within two months, led by Han Xin, and pursued Xiang Yu.The final decisive battle between Chu and Han began.
